hydroxyproline and Hypoxia

hydroxyproline has been researched along with Hypoxia in 49 studies

Hydroxyproline: A hydroxylated form of the imino acid proline. A deficiency in ASCORBIC ACID can result in impaired hydroxyproline formation.
hydroxyproline : A proline derivative that is proline substituted by at least one hydroxy group.

Hypoxia: Sub-optimal OXYGEN levels in the ambient air of living organisms.
